The federal government awarded a $1.7 million no-bid contract to Green Water Solutions, a company owned by a donor to former President Trump, for a new water cleaning system at the Lincoln Memorial Reflecting Pool. The contract aims to address issues like algae blooms and peeling paint at the historic site.

John J. Cafaro, owner of the Ohio-based company, has a history of political donations to Republican candidates and conservative causes, including significant contributions to Trump's campaigns. Federal Election Commission records indicate he has also donated to Democrats. Cafaro has previously pleaded guilty to campaign finance violations in 2010 and to conspiring to bribe a congressman nearly a decade earlier, for which he cooperated with prosecutors.

Green Water Solutions, also known as Greenwater Services, specializes in water purification using a "Nano Bubble" filtration system. The company's website details its ability to remove algae, bacteria, and other contaminants. Federal records show one other government contract for Green Water Solutions: a $1 million feasibility study in 2025 for treating sewage flows in the Tijuana River. The company also posted on its LinkedIn page about performing water treatment work on a pond at a Trump Organization golf club in Bedminster, New Jersey.

Inquiries to Cafaro and executives at Green Water Solutions did not yield a response regarding the contract. The New York Times was the first to report on Cafaro's involvement in the Reflecting Pool project. The Reflecting Pool, a century-old basin, has struggled with algae blooms for years, prompting President Trump's push for renovations.
